Love this, makes me think I could actually do it in my kitchen. 2 questions: how did you hang your range hood over the tile? And why, please share, I'm so curious, do ;you have a small saggy butt tattoo on your left wrist? Thanks!!!
@kelly_mcgrath
@kelly_mcgrath 11 ай бұрын
It’s a number 3 written in my grandmothers handwriting haha, definitely not a saggy butt. I pre-drilled the holes for the range and hung it up before tiling to confirm the location, then tiled and rehung with longer screws after the tile was completed. That way the tile was seamless all the way up the wall
